How much does it cost to rent an apartment in McKinney?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| McKinney Studio Apartments | $942 | $935 | $950 |
| McKinney 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,310 | $600 | $2,858 |
| McKinney 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,555 | $825 | $3,069 |
| McKinney 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,099 | $935 | $3,320 |
